So going back to the comparison. The Specialized has very nice Control SL carbon wheels (around 1300g a pair). Also I prefer the XX1 cranks + XTR transmission to the AXS. Thing is, one in twenty-thirty rides you are going to forget the battery in your charger at home, or forget to charge it or whatever. The XTR is a top of the line proven technology, The AXS is nice, very precise, but not foolproof because of the battery handling. The battery also degrades (don’t hear many talking about that). It is foolproof in what setup is concerned. Switching is smooth and accurate, so there’s nothing wrong with it. It’s a fraction of a second slower than the XTR, not sure if enough to actually make a difference, but it is something you feel.
I lean towards the Specialized. It also feels more compact, more nimble. I’ve seen a lot of reviewers saying the geometry of the epic feels just right. It works even on harder terrain where it should have no right to be.
